BSA Troop #214's Newest Eagle Scouts

This weekend at Central Synagogue of Nassau County in Rockville Centre, Town of Hempstead Senior Councilman Anthony J. Santino, Town Clerk Nasrin Ahmad, Assemblyman Brian Curran and Rockville Centre Mayor Fran Murray joined together to salute the newest Eagle Scouts of Boy Scouts of America Troop 214.

In a filled-to-capacity room, newly minted Eagle Scouts Cody Olszewski, Matthew Goldstein and Kevin Kimmons were presented with the highest rank in scouting - one which they earned by achieving a minimum of 21 merit badges, an Eagle service project and appearing before an Eagle Review Board.

Santino, Ahmad, Curran and Murray saluted these fine young men as tomorrow's leaders due to their tenacity and dedication to community.
